Inventors list

Assignees list

Classification tree browser

Top 100 Inventors

Top 100 Assignees


Sanjay Garg

Sanjay Garg, Bangalore IN

Patent application numberDescriptionPublished
20080211959METHODS AND SYSTEMS FOR IMPROVING LOW-RESOLUTION VIDEO - Systems and methods are provided for improving the visual quality of low-resolution video displayed on large-screen displays. A video format converter may be used to process a low-resolution video signal from a media providing device before the video is displayed. The video format converter may detect the true resolution of the video and deinterlace the video signal accordingly. For low-resolution videos that are also low in quality, the video format converter may reduce compression artifacts and apply techniques to enhance the appearance of the video.09-04-2008
20090316050SPLIT EDGE ENHANCEMENT ARCHITECTURE - A system and method for enhancing the detail edges and transitions in an input video signal. This enhancement may be accomplished by enhancing small detail edges before up-scaling and enhancing large amplitude transitions after up-scaling. For example, detail edge enhancement (detail EE) may be used to enhance the fine details of an input video signal. An edge map may be used to prevent enhancing the large edges and accompanying mosquito noise with the detail enhancement. Noise may additionally be removed from the signal. After the fine details are enhanced, the signal may be up-scaled. Luminance transition improvement (LTI) or chrominance transition improvement (CTI) may be used to enhance the large transitions of the input video signal post scaler.12-24-2009
20100060749REDUCING DIGITAL IMAGE NOISE - Devices, systems, methods, and other embodiments associated with reducing digital image noise are described. In one embodiment, a method includes determining, on a per pixel basis, mosquito noise values associated with pixels of a digital image. The method determines, on a per pixel basis, block noise values associated with the digital image. The method filters the digital image with a plurality of adaptive filters. A compression artifact in the digital image is reduced. The compression artifact is reduced by combining filter outputs from the plurality of adaptive filters. The filter outputs are combined based, at least in part, on the mosquito noise values and the block noise values.03-11-2010
20100134496BIT RESOLUTION ENHANCEMENT - Devices, systems, apparatuses, methods, and other embodiments associated with bit resolution enhancement are described. In one embodiment, an apparatus includes logic configured to produce a high-resolution pixel from a low-resolution pixel. The apparatus includes logic configured to classify the high-resolution pixel as being in a smooth region of an image based on at least one of a gradient value and a variance value associated with the low-resolution pixel. The apparatus includes logic configured to selectively re-classify the high-resolution pixel as not being in the smooth region of the image based on a set of neighboring high-resolution pixels associated with high-resolution pixel. The apparatus includes logic configured to selectively filter the high-resolution pixel based on whether the high-resolution pixel remains classified as being in the smooth region of the image.06-03-2010
20100253838CADENCE DETECTION IN PROGRESSIVE VIDEO - Devices, methods, and other embodiments associated with cadence detection are discussed. In one embodiment, an apparatus analyzes a progressive video stream and determines a cadence pattern from the progressive video stream.10-07-2010

Patent applications by Sanjay Garg, Bangalore IN

Sanjay Garg, Hanover, NH US

Patent application numberDescriptionPublished
20080249733PLASMA INSENSITIVE HEIGHT SENSING - A method for determining a distance between a first piece and a second piece includes measuring, at the first or second piece, a first signal at a first frequency, and measuring, at the first or second piece, a second signal at a second frequency. The second frequency is different from the first frequency. The distance is determined based on the measured first and second signals.10-09-2008
20100109681Plasma Insensitive Height Sensing - A method for determining a distance between a first piece and a second piece includes measuring, at the first or second piece, an AC signal, and determining the distance based on the measured AC signal. A system for determining a distance between a first piece and a second piece includes a measuring device adapted to measure, at one or both of the first and second piece, an AC signal, and a signal processing device adapted to determine the distance based on the measured AC signal. The AC signal includes a DC offset.05-06-2010

Sanjay Garg, Redmond, WA US

Patent application numberDescriptionPublished
20090326964EXTENSIBLE AGENT-BASED LICENSE STRUCTURE - An extensible licensing system is described that allows modification of the way a product is licensed by third parties after the product has been released. The third party provides a licensing agent that includes a user interface that supplants the user interface for licensing provided by the application. The system invokes the third party licensing agent to obtain licensing information from the user. The system receives licensing information from the licensing agent and allows the application to function using the licensing information. Thus, a third party can create a seamless licensing experience where the user performs licensing steps for one or more applications through the third party's integrated user interface.12-31-2009

Sanjay Garg, Bellevue, WA US

Patent application numberDescriptionPublished
20090327091LICENSE MANAGEMENT FOR SOFTWARE PRODUCTS - Technologies are described herein for software product license management. Following a click to run paradigm, manual user entry of product keys and manual user involvement in product activation may be avoided. A software product key can be associated with a user ID. The product key and associated user ID can be stored on a remote application server. The product key can be retrieved from the application server using the user ID or related user credentials. An application retrieving its own product key from the application server can be supported. The user-centric approach to product key management can be useful for software license models based on subscriptions, trial software, virtual software, downloadable software, or purely web based solutions as well as traditional software license purchases. The software product can also be autonomously activated. This activation can occur as a background operation within the application client portion of the software.12-31-2009